Market Scenario:
Ventilator-associated pneumonia is a type of lung infection caused to patients who are on ventilators. Ventilator-associated pneumonia is caused mainly due to lung disease, neurologic disease, and trauma to critically ill persons. Diagnosing VAP requires aggressive surveillance combined with the radiographic examination, bedside examination, and microbiologic examinations of respiratory secretions. Growing Intensive Care Unit Admissions due to rising prevalence of respiratory diseases, rising number of ICU beds and high incidence of traumatic injuries provides favorable backgrounds for the market to grow. According to CDC in 2013, there were 2.8 million traumatic brain injury visits to emergency department and hospitals. The emergency department visits of brain injury patients increased by 47% from 2007. Thus, increasing incidence of TBI drives the growth of the market. Furthermore, increasing geriatric population is likely to fuel the market to grow. According to the U.S. Census Bureau in 2015, 47.8 million people were 65 years or older, and in 2060, 98.2 million are expected to be 65 years or older. Such increasing trend in the geriatric population provides favorable backgrounds for the market to grow.

Regional Analysis
Globally, Ventilator-associated pneumonia (VAP) market consists of four regions Americas, Europe, Asia Pacific and Middle East & Africa. America is the largest market for Ventilator-associated pneumonia (VAP) whose growth is contributed to increase in prevalence of smoking leading to lung diseases, large number of patients suffering from chronic heart diseases and demand of mechanical ventilators. The market is growing continuously in Europe due to extensive demand of medical devices in hospitals, and increasing healthcare expenditure. Asia Pacific is expected to be the fastest growing market owing to increase in environmental pollution, high incidence of asthma & chronic obstructive pulmonary disease and large patient pool. Moreover, Awareness regarding prevention of hospital acquired infection, pneumonia and quality control measures taken by hospitals for control of nosocomial infection favour the growth of this market. Increasing ageing population and incidence of infectious disease too contribute for the growth of this market in Asia Pacific. On the other hand, the Middle East & Africa region are likely to have a limited but steady growth in the market.
